Miami Gardens is a vibrant, diverse suburb located midway between Miami and Fort Lauderdale in north central Miami-Dade County, bordering Broward County. Miami Gardens is home to the Hard Rock Stadium, where the Miami Dolphins and the University of Miami Hurricanes play. Calder Race Track is also situated in Miami Gardens.
Miami Gardens contains commercial shopping districts for the furniture and automobile trades along the Palmetto Expressway and U.S. 441, respectively. Saint Thomas University and Florida Memorial University both call Miami Gardens home too. Convenience to I-95, the Palmetto Expressway, and Florida’s Turnpike as well as the Florida East Coast Railway and the South Florida Tri-Rail System makes commuting and traveling from Miami Gardens simple.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
